Two dead, including a teen boy, and others hurt in shooting after a funeral at a Florida church
A 15-year-old boy and a man have been killed in a shooting at a funeral in Florida today.
A second child and a woman were also injured when the shooter fired 13 rounds of bullets at Victory City Church in Riviera Beach, police said.
The shooting happened as the service was closing just after 2.30pm, reports NBC.
A woman and a juvenile were also shot and taken to hospital for treatment, Riviera Beach Police said.
The church’s senior pastor, Tywuante D. Lupoe posted about the tragedy on Facebook.
He wrote: “We solicit prayers of the saints today as we mourn the loss of two young black men to a senseless shooting after a funeral held here at a church.
The shooter fled the scene in what has been dubbed “Florida’s most dangerous city”.
Police said the investigation is open and no arrests have been made.
